Tarkwa-Zongo Mosque Commissioned

Tarkwa (W/R), Nov. 7, GNA- Sheik Abubakar Alkajabi, representative of the Zaatu Nidaakein, an Islamic humanitarian services society on Thursday commissioned a 187.6 million cedis mosque for the Tarkwa-Zongo community at Tarkwa.

Al-Muntada Islam, a Saudi Arabian-based non-governmental organisation (NGO), financed the mosque, which has a sitting capacity for about 1,000 worshippers.

The community provided labour on the project that took three months to complete.

Commissioning it, Sheik Alkajabi expressed the people's gratitude to Al-Muntada for the assistance and said the project should inspire Muslims to live by the teachings of the Holy Quran.

He called on leaders of the community to work to maintain the love, unity and understanding that existed among the people, and urged them to initiate more development projects.

Alhaji Amadu Ali, chairman of the project planning committee thanked Al-Muntada and hoped similar assistance would be extended to other Muslim communities in the district.

Nana Kwamena Faibil III, former Apintohene of Wassa Fiase Traditional area, advised the community to maintain the project regularly to prolong its lifespan and keep the environment clean.
